About LASIK in Maryland

Maryland offers 53 LASIK eye surgery centers with an average cost of $2,500 per eye. Prices range from $2,000 to $3,000 depending on the technology used and each person's vision correction needs. 92% of centers in Maryland offer financing options to help make LASIK more affordable.

LASIK (Laser-Assisted In Situ Keratomileusis) is a popular vision correction procedure that reshapes the cornea using laser technology to treat n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ism. The procedure typically takes less than 30 minutes, with most patients experiencing improved vision within 24 hours.

When comparing LASIK providers in Maryland, consider not only price but also the surgeon's experience, technologies offered, and patient reviews. Look for centers that provide free consultations, which allow you to meet the surgeon and discuss your specific needs without obligation.
